I appear to be having this same nightmare. My Xeneon Edge arrived today. I connected the USB-C to USB-C cable to the 20G USB-C port on the back of my motherboard, and the HMDI>DP connection to one of the ports on my GPU.

Motherboard - ASUS ROG Strix Z790-E Gaming WiFi
GPU - ASUS ROG Strix RTX 4090
OS - Windows 11 25H2

The device works fine as another screen. I have it set to extend the desktop to the Xeneon (not duplicate). However, although the device shows in iCUE, it cannot be configured. When you click on the XENEON EDGE tile on the iCUE dashboard, I get this:

<image>

I have connected it using the USB cable (into a USB-C on the back of my motherboard) and the HDMI>DP cable (into my GPU).

I have uninstalled iCUE then restarted my computer. Then reinstalled the latest version and restarted my computer again. I have uninstalled GPU-Z, HWMonitor and Logitech G Hub. I cannot think of any other conflicting applications.

Any ideas?
